The importance of regular exercise cannot be overstated. Engaging in physical activity has numerous benefits for both physical and mental health. From improving cardiovascular health to boosting mood, regular exercise plays a crucial role in maintaining a healthy lifestyle.

Benefits of Regular Exercise

One of the most significant advantages of regular exercise is its positive impact on heart health. Engaging in activities such as running, swimming, or cycling strengthens the heart muscle, improves circulation, and can lower blood pressure. These benefits contribute to a reduced risk of heart disease, which is a leading cause of death worldwide.

Additionally, exercise is a powerful tool for weight management. By burning calories and building muscle, regular physical activity helps individuals maintain a healthy weight or lose excess pounds. This is particularly important in today’s society, where obesity rates are on the rise. By incorporating exercise into daily routines, individuals can combat the effects of a sedentary lifestyle.

Beyond physical benefits, exercise has a profound effect on mental well-being. Regular physical activity releases endorphins, often referred to as “feel-good” hormones, which can alleviate symptoms of anxiety and depression. Many people find that even a short walk can significantly improve their mood and overall outlook on life.

Moreover, exercise can enhance cognitive function. Studies have shown that regular physical activity improves memory, attention, and overall brain function. This is especially beneficial for older adults, as staying active can help fend off cognitive decline and reduce the risk of dementia.

Incorporating exercise into daily life doesn’t have to be daunting. Simple changes, such as taking the stairs instead of the elevator or going for a brisk walk during lunch breaks, can make a significant difference. Additionally, finding an enjoyable activity, whether it be dancing, hiking, or participating in team sports, can help individuals stick with an exercise routine.

In conclusion, the benefits of regular exercise are vast and varied. From improving physical health to enhancing mental well-being, engaging in consistent physical activity is essential for a balanced lifestyle. By prioritizing exercise, individuals can experience the numerous advantages it brings, leading to a healthier and happier life.
